Romain Guy dda570201a Add a layer (FBO) cache.
The cache is used to draw layers so that a new
texture does not have to be recreated every time
a call to saveLayer() happens.

The FBO cache used a KeyedVector, which is a bad
idea. The cache should be able to store several
FBOs of the same size (this happens a lot during
scrolling with fading edges for instance.) This
will be changed in a future CL.

#ifndef ANDROID_UI_LAYER_CACHE_H
#define ANDROID_UI_LAYER_CACHE_H
#include "Layer.h"
#include "GenerationCache.h"
namespace android {
namespace uirenderer {
class LayerCache: public OnEntryRemoved<LayerSize, Layer*> {
public:
LayerCache(uint32_t maxByteSize);
~LayerCache();
/**
* Used as a callback when an entry is removed from the cache.
* Do not invoke directly.
*/
void operator()(LayerSize& bitmap, Layer*& texture);
/**
* Returns the layer of specified dimensions, NULL if cannot be found.
*/
Layer* get(LayerSize& size);
/**
* Adds the layer to the cache. The layer will not be added if there is
* not enough space available.
*
* @return True if the layer was added, false otherwise.
*/
bool put(LayerSize& size, Layer* layer);
/**
* Clears the cache. This causes all layers to be deleted.
*/
void clear();
/**
* Sets the maximum size of the cache in bytes.
*/
void setMaxSize(uint32_t maxSize);
/**
* Returns the maximum size of the cache in bytes.
*/
uint32_t getMaxSize();
/**
* Returns the current size of the cache in bytes.
*/
uint32_t getSize();
private:
void deleteLayer(Layer* layer);
GenerationCache<LayerSize, Layer*> mCache;
uint32_t mSize;
uint32_t mMaxSize;
}; // class LayerCache
}; // namespace uirenderer
}; // namespace android
#endif // ANDROID_UI_LAYER_CACHE_H
